No light at Assam-Nagaland Border

The sensitive border area of Sonapur is yet undevelopment. In mid-2007 the Naga intruded this area of Assam & killed several people. After that barbarous incident the Assam Govt. declared to set-up three border out posts (BOP) at Sonapur, Soraihujia & Borhula to protect the life and prosperity of the people.

The BOP of Sunapur was set-up on last 20th September 2007 with 50 nos battalions, but the Govt. is not yet provide adequate facilities to this B.O.P. They are facing the problem of drinking water, electricity etc. and the number of battalions are not sufficient to protect the border. Battalions are doing their duty in the light of harikan lamps.

The Nazira Civil administration is fully prepared for the ensuing Assambly Election  2016. There are 1,18,794 voters in the constituency with 159 nos. polling stations. For free and fair election at Nazira constituency the Election Commission recruits 4 Divisional officers,16 sector officers and 600 polling officers. Central election observer  R. B. Prajapoti and election expenditure observer Noresh Bundal monitoring the electrol process and progress.

Alleging about the neglect and deprivation faced  by the Ahom community of Nazira constituency the Members of the All Assam Tai Ahom burnt effigies of BJP state president Sarbananda Sonowal and MP  Kamakhya Prashad Tasa in front of the Nazira BJP office.  They raised slogans against the party and held that due to a conspiracy between Sonowal and Tasa the Ahom community of Nazira remains depraved. Despite having the majority number of voters, candidates of Ahom descent never chanced to contest from Nazira constituency they added.
